require('ts-node/register/transpile-only');
const assert = require('node:assert/strict');
const { test } = require('node:test');
const {
PrimaryRunStartupSupervisor,
} = require('../../back/runtime/application/primaryRunStartupSupervisor');
function page(overrides = {}) {
return {
scanned: 1,
verifiedRunning: 0,
recoveredRunning: 1,
completedFromReceipt: 0,
quarantinedReceipts: 0,
publishGraceWaits: 0,
markedLost: 0,
skipped: 0,
ambiguous: 0,
failed: 0,
truncated: false,
unsafeAttemptOverflow: false,
...overrides,
};
}
test('startup supervisor aggregates bounded pages until recovery completes', async () => {
const cursors = [];
const responses = [
page({
truncated: true,
nextCursor: { createdAtMs: 10, runId: 'run-1' },
}),
page({ verifiedRunning: 1, recoveredRunning: 0, markedLost: 1 }),
];
const supervisor = new PrimaryRunStartupSupervisor({
async reconcileBatch(options) {
cursors.push(options.cursor);
return responses.shift();
},
});
const result = await supervisor.run({ pageSize: 8, maxPages: 4 });
assert.deepEqual(cursors, [undefined, { createdAtMs: 10, runId: 'run-1' }]);
assert.deepEqual(result, {
pages: 2,
scanned: 2,
verifiedRunning: 1,
recoveredRunning: 1,
completedFromReceipt: 0,
quarantinedReceipts: 0,
publishGraceWaits: 0,
markedLost: 1,
skipped: 0,
ambiguous: 0,
failed: 0,
stopReason: 'complete',
remaining: false,
});
});
test('startup supervisor fails closed for overflow, stalled cursor, and page limit', async () => {
const overflow = new PrimaryRunStartupSupervisor({
async reconcileBatch() {
return page({ unsafeAttemptOverflow: true, truncated: true });
},
});
assert.equal((await overflow.run()).stopReason, 'unsafe_attempt_overflow');
const stalled = new PrimaryRunStartupSupervisor({
async reconcileBatch() {
return page({ truncated: true });
},
});
assert.equal((await stalled.run()).stopReason, 'cursor_stalled');
let sequence = 0;
const limited = new PrimaryRunStartupSupervisor({
async reconcileBatch() {
sequence += 1;
return page({
truncated: true,
nextCursor: { createdAtMs: sequence, runId: `run-${sequence}` },
});
},
});
const limitedResult = await limited.run({ maxPages: 2 });
assert.equal(limitedResult.stopReason, 'page_limit');
assert.equal(limitedResult.remaining, true);
assert.deepEqual(limitedResult.nextCursor, {
createdAtMs: 2,
runId: 'run-2',
});
});
test('startup supervisor rejects unbounded settings', async () => {
const supervisor = new PrimaryRunStartupSupervisor({
async reconcileBatch() {
return page();
},
});
await assert.rejects(supervisor.run({ pageSize: 0 }), RangeError);
await assert.rejects(supervisor.run({ maxPages: 65 }), RangeError);
});
